Try 30 days of free premium.

Stephen David

We don't have a biography for Stephen David yet. Hang in there, or go ahead and contribute one.

Known For

Credits


Crew Credits

The Crystal Maze (2020)
Show crew as Executive Producer
Roman Empire (2016)
Show crew as Executive Producer
Episode crew as Writer (6 episodes)
Sons of Liberty (2015)
Episode crew as Writer (3 episodes)
Try 30 days of free premium.